Is kids Disney cherry flavored lip balm hazardous to reef environment? Long story short took a friend and his 2 kids out for lunch today brought them back to look at tank and then took them home unbeknownst to me one of his daughters dropped her lip balm into the tank and did not discover it til I came back an hr later.

My guess is it will be fine, but in a pinch you can do a water change and swap out the carbon (or put some on if you don't already) just to be safe.

I doubt the water was warm enough to melt it, or alternatively if it was, that enough would melt to cause a problem in an hour or two. Run some carbon or do a waterchange if you like but I highly doubt you'll see any adverse effects.
